THE BRESLAU ENGAGED.

■ATTACKED J?Y RUSSIAN

DESTROYER

APPARENTLY BADLY DAMAGED.

Oleceived June 1-1, 0.30 a.m.)

PetrogratJ, June 13

Two of our torpedoers on Friday right near the Bosphoras, encountered the Breslau, whose searchlight showed up a Russian kii'Mne 'destroyer.

The latter attacked the cruiser, and a violent exchange of shells occurred. Several struck the Breslau, and an explosion was heard, fire being seen in her bows. ~ The darkness prevented us from seeing the extent of the damage. We had an officoi and six men wounded.
